Quiche, a classic French dish, is a savory pastry consisting of a flaky crust filled with eggs, milk or cream, and various fillings such as cheese, meat, seafood, or vegetables. It is often served warm or at room temperature and can be enjoyed for breakfast, lunch, or dinner. This versatile dish has many variations, each with its own unique flavor and texture. From the classic Quiche Lorraine, featuring bacon and Gruyère cheese, to the hearty Sausage and Spinach Quiche, or the indulgent Mushroom and Goat Cheese Quiche, there is a quiche recipe to suit every taste and occasion. "REAL MEN" DO MAKE QUICHE



A cheesy fluffy goodness that the whole family LOVES!!! I always make Two, all the way for Mom and I and a meat & cheese version for the young Wentzes....mmmmmm good.

Provided by Bill Wentz

Categories     Savory Pies

Time 1h15m

Number Of Ingredients 11

6 medium eggs
8 oz whipping cream
1 small yellow onion diced
1 pkg 10 oz frozen chopped spinach
6 oz grated swiss cheese
1 tsp salt
1 tsp black pepper
1 tsp cayenne pepper
1 pkg 9 inch deep dish pie crust
4 pinch grated asiago cheese
10 slice oscar meyer center cut bacon (or your favorite)

Steps:

  • 1. preheat oven to 425*. line a baking pan with 10-12 slices of your favorite bacon (I use Oscar Meyer center cut) bake at 400* for 12-14 minutes. While bacon is cooking prepare your chopped spinach in the microwave per package instructions, remove and carefully squeeze out excess water and place in a dish at your station. Remove bacon from oven and place slices on a paper towel to drain, use kitchen shears and cut into small pieces.
  • 2. remove frozen pie crust from freezer and place at your work station while you chop and dice the onion. Go ahead now and grate your swiss cheese(on wax paper for ease of transport) in a medium bowl slightly beat the 6 eggs add your salt, pepper, cayenne and whipping cream mix lightly. place the diced onion in the bottom of your pie crust, followed by the cut bacon, then layered with the chopped spinach. Place your grated swiss on top of the spinach, then carefully pour your egg mixture over the top, slowly to allow absorption. sprinkle top with asiago cheese.
  • 3. place your Quiche in pre-heated 425* oven for 15 minutes, at the end of 15 minutes reduce heat to 325* and bake an additional 25-30 minutes until tops are a golden brown
  • 4. remove from oven allow to r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ing. Slice, Plate and ENJOY mmmmmm GOOD!! Recipe is for "One" Quiche in my photos I was making the Kids Quiche as well (with sausage and cheddar)

REAL MEN DO EAT QUICHE



Real Men Do Eat Quiche image

Somebody wrote a book once and the title was "Real Men Don't Eat Quiche."It stuck with me for many years but I never gave it another thought as I used the phrase.The truth however is that quiche can be delicate or hearty, depending on the ingredients.This recipe would be a hearty breakfast (or lunch with a salad) for anyone and a...

Provided by Sandra McGrath

Categories     Savory Pies

Time 50m

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 deep dish pre-made pie crust, frozen or refrigerated
1 lb kielbasa, turkey sausage, italian sausage or stick of peperoni
1 c frozen hash browns or other frozen potato
8 eggs, beaten
1/2 c half and half
1 small onion, chopped
1/2 c chopped fresh parsley or cilantro
1 red pepper, seeded and chopped
2 c shredded cheddar cheese or any other variety

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.Beat the eggs in a bowl with the half and half. Add the cheese and parsley/cilantro and place in the bottom of each pie plate dividing ingredients evenly. If using refrigerated dough you will have to place the rolled out crust in your own pie plate first.
  • 2. cook the meat in a nonstick pan or spray with Pam, (use a pat of butter if you like!).Add tne frozen hash browns, the peppers and onions but do not brown the onions.
  • 3. Cool the meat and vegatables a bit and add to egg mixture in the pie plates, again dividing evenly and mix slightly to incorporate. Bake at 350 degrees for 35-40 minutes. Check for doneness before removing from the oven by touching the top lightly with you finger which should not be wet or jiggly but somewhat firm.

MANLY QUICHE/OMELET PIE (REAL MEN "DO" EAT QUICHE)



Manly Quiche/Omelet Pie (Real Men

You have your eggs, bacon & sausage (& other veggies & cheese) all in one. Guys...try to think of it as an omelet in pie form or Omelet Pie! Mmmmmmmmmmmmmmmm!

Provided by Kimmi Knippel (Sweet_Memories)

Categories     Other Breakfast

Time 1h35m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 stick butter
4 oz mushrooms, fresh, sliced
1 medium onion, diced
3 oz italian sausage, no casings, crumbled
1 sheet pillsbury refrigerated pie crust dough (pillsbury works great)
4 slice bacon
3 c italian blend or cheddar cheese, shredded
4 x large eggs
1 c heavy cream, cold
salt & pepper, to taste
garlic powder. to taste

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.
  • 2. In a large skillet, add sausage & bacon, cook, until no longer pink; 5 - 8 minutes.
  • 3. Add butter, onions & mushrooms, season with salt, pepper & garlic powder; cook until onions are translucent; 10 minutes. Set aside & cool slightly, 10 minutes.
  • 4. Fit dough into 9" pie plate; flute edge.
  • 5. Sprinkle enough cheese in bottom of crust, about ½ - 1 C.
  • 6. Beat eggs with cream, salt, pepper & garlic powder. Pour into crust; sprinkle with about ½ - 1 C cheese.
  • 7. Bake 50 minutes or until set & golden. Immediately out of oven, sprinkle with remaining cheese. Let stand 20 minutes before serving.

REAL MEN DO EAT QUICHE



Real Men Do Eat Quiche image

This is a delicious quiche. Another one of those church cookbooks, from Georgia, had this winning recipe.

Provided by out of here

Categories     Vegetable

Time 45m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 (12 ounce) package frozen prepared spinach souffle, thawed
2 eggs, slightly beaten
3 tablespoons milk
2 teaspoons chopped onions
1 (4 1/2 ounce) jar sliced mushrooms, drained
3/4 cup cooked sausage, crumbled
3/4 cup cheddar cheese, grated
1 unbaked 9-inch pie crust

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ees.
  • In a large mixing bowl, combine spinach souffle, eggs, milk onion, mushrooms, sausage and cheese. Mix thoroughly.
  • Pour the mixture into the unbaked pie crust.
  • Put a baking sheet on the bottom oven rack. Place quiche on the middle rack of the oven. Bake 30-35 minutes, or until a knife inserted in center comes out clean.

THE REAL MAN'S QUICHE



The Real Man's Quiche image

This is an adaptation of a recipe that was given to me by a friend a couple of decades ago when I was a newlywed. It is still one of my family's favorites. It is great to pull out of the freezer when I don't have time to cook.

Provided by Grammerose

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 1h20m

Yield 2 quiches

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 1/2 lbs ground beef
2 9-inch deep dish pie crusts, unbaked
1/2 cup sliced fresh mushrooms, any kind
1/2 cup chopped fresh broccoli
1/2 cup chopped canned artichoke heart
1 cup shredded fresh parmesan cheese
1 cup shredded mild cheddar cheese
2 teaspoons onion powder
1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
1/2 teaspoon onion salt
1 teaspoon seasoning salt
6 eggs
2 cups whipping cream

Steps:

  • Bake pie crusts 5 minutes at 425 degrees F.
  • Brown meat and drain well.
  • Steam broccoli and mushrooms.
  • Mix broccoli, mushrooms, artichokes and meat together and spread in pie shell.
  • Sprinkle Parmesan and Cheddar cheeses over meat and vegetable mixture in shells.
  • Beat eggs, cream and seasonings together and pour over meat pie filling.
  • Bake at 425 degrees F.
  • for 15 minutes then reduce heat to 300 degrees F.
  • and bake 35 minutes more.
  • This makes two quiches so there is an extra one to freeze or share with another real man!

Tips:

  • Choose the right cheese: Use a cheese that melts well and has a strong flavor, such as Gruyère, Cheddar, or Parmesan.
  • Don't overcook the eggs: The eggs should be set but still slightly runny in the center.
  • Use a good quality pastry: A good quality pastry will make all the difference in the final product.
  • Blind bake the pastry: This will help to prevent the pastry from becoming soggy.
  • Use fresh ingredients: Fresh ingredients will give your quiche the best flavor.
  • Don't be afraid to experiment: There are many different ways to make quiche, so feel free to experiment with different ingredients and flavors.
